H-2 associated differences in the weight of some androgen influenced organs in (C57BL/10ScSnPh X AKR/J) F2 individuals.

S Gregorová, P Iványi.   

Abstract

We have followed the possible influence of H-2 system on the differences in the relative weights of testes, vesicular gland and thymus in animals of a segregating (B10 X AKR) F2 generation. H-2b/H-2b male mice had significantly higher values of relative vesicular gland weight and significantly lower values of relative testes weight than H-2k/H-2k males. No differences in the relative thymus weight were found between these two groups of animals. The differences are caused by a complex effect of the H.2 associated genetic factor(s) because they influence simultaneously the body weight and the organ weights, the two indicators being mutually dependent to some extent.
